



The Journey of Pius Muleme
From an Impossible Debt to an IT Degree
In the quiet village of Namayamba, Pius Muleme grew up with his mother and eight siblings. Life was marked by a constant struggle for survival, and the burden of school fees always hung heavy over his family. Though Pius managed to complete his Senior Four exams, he was left with a massive school debt of over one million Ugandan shillings. At that point, the dream of continuing his studies seemed entirely impossible.
Finding Hope Through BLF
When he hit a dead end, hope found its way to him. Through a friend, Kyambadde Samson, Pius was connected to the late Jajja Mukyala, who then introduced him to Dr. Josephine Kyambadde, the CEO of The Balanced Life Family (BLF).
That introduction became the turning point of his life. BLF stepped in and completely changed the trajectory of Pius's future. They cleared his debts and opened new doors for his development. He joined the Mata Soccer Academy, where he honed his athletic skills, and was later enrolled at World Ahead Secondary School. Since 2019, BLF has not only covered his school fees but has also provided him with consistent mentorship, structure, and opportunities to grow as a young leader.
A New Beginning in Tech
What once seemed like the tragic end of his education became a powerful new beginning. Today, Pius is pursuing his Bachelor of Science in Information Technology at St. Lawrence University, building the foundation for a brilliant career in the tech industry.
